Walk Description

Ivinghoe Beacon a is a prominent hill and landmark in the Chiltern Hills, standing 233 m (757 ft) above sea level. It is situated close to the villages of Ivinghoe, and Aldbury in Bucks, the Ashridge Estate, and the village of Little Gaddesden in Hertfordshire, and is managed and owned by the National Trust. Ivinghoe Beacon lies between the towns of Dunstable, Berkhamsted and Tring. It is the starting point of the Icknield Way to the east, and the Ridgeway to the west.

The walk takes in panoramic views of the surrounding villages from along the ridge. One point of particular interest is the Whipsnade White Lion made in 1933 on the slope just below the Whipsnade wildlife park.
